PUCRS – Pontifical University of Rio Grande do Sul was a great experience. My stay at the University was full of academic and professional activities, It has everything you need within the campus. I haven’t had much experience with the student support services but I’ve heard from friends that they’re pretty good. I used to love seeing lecturers who are really enthusiastic about their subject. There’s also a hospital that belongs to the university right next to it.

I was able to learn from professors who have experience in the professional market, and not stay just in theory as I see in other great universities. Your campus has a very good structure and is similar to first-world countries. Because of well-defined classes (always on the night shift), I was able to do an internship from the beginning. I studied for 6 months in Canada thanks to an agreement that I managed to sign between PUCRS and Polytechnique Montréal, and it was a huge experience not only academically, but professionally and personally, where I met people and cultures from all over the world.

Talking a bit about the Engineering School (called FENG), there are lots of skilled professors, the library is comfortable and full of actualized books. The engineers graduated on FENG are qualified and have been hired for many jobs around the world.
The campus is beautiful and wooded, has lots of places to sit and have a good conversation.
It was a pleasure to study there.
